no audio with dvdstyler


For some reason when I make an iso with dvdstyler, it doesn't keep the sound with the files. I made dvd compatible mpg files with the tovid suite and they have sound there, but it's menu creation is not as good as dvdstyler. I haven't actucaly burned the iso yet only watch it in mplayer. Also when I don't have it delete the temp files, it have the video files in Video_ts and nothing in audio_ts. So I don't think it's even making the audio part of the movie. Anyone know what could be causing this?
